AN ORDINANCE APPROVING AND AUTHORIZING AN INTERLOCAL AGREEMENT
BETWEEN THE CITY OF LA PORTE AND THE LA PORTE INDEPENDENT SCHOOL
DISTRICT FOR PROVISION OF SIX PATROL OFFICERS AT LA PORTE
INDEPENDENT SCHOOL DISTRICT SCHOOLS, DURING THE SCHOOL YEAR;
MAKING VARIOUS FINDINGS AND PROVISIONS RELATING TO THE SUBJECT,
FINDING COMPLIANCE WITH THE OPEN MEETINGS LAW, AND PROVIDING AN
EFFECTIVE DTE HEREOF.
B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F LA PORTE:
Section 1. The City Council hereby approves and
authorizes the contract, agreement, or other undertaking
described in the title of this ordinance, a copy of which is on
file in the office of the City Secretary. The City Manager is
hereby authorized to execute such document and all related
documents on behalf of the City of La Porte. The City Secretary
is hereby authorized to attest to all such signatures and to
affix the seal of the city to all such documents.
Section 2. The City Council officially finds,
determines, recites, and declares that a sufficient written
notice of the date, hour, place and subject of this meeting of
the City Council was posted at a place convenient to the public
at the City Hall of the City for the time requires by law
preceding this meeting, as required by the Open Meetings Law,
Chapter 551, Texas Government Code; and that this meeting has
been open to the public as required by law at all times during
which this ordinance and the subject matter thereof has been
discussed, considered and formally acted upon. The City Council
further ratifies, approves and confirms such written notice and
the contents and posting thereof.
Section 3. This Ordinance shall be effective from and
after its passage and approval, and it is so ordered.
